PYRROLOQUINOLINE QUINONE DISODIUM SALT Usage And Synthesis
DescriptionPyrroloquinoline quinone disodium salt is a water-soluble quinone compound that has a strong anti-oxidant capacity.
UsesPyrroloquinoline quinone disodium salt can act as an antioxidant and there is strong evidence that PQQ may play an important role in important pathways of cell signaling. PQQ plays a variety of physiological roles, such as promoting growth and reproduction and providing neurological and cardiovascular protection.
ApplicationPyrroloquinoline quinone disodium salt protects cells from oxidative damage and increases the mitochondrial membrane potential, which is essential for the production of ATP. It also stimulates enzyme activities, such as glutathione peroxidase and glutathione reductase, and prevents lipid peroxidation of human serum. This compound also inhibits radiation-induced cellular damage by preventing DNA strand breakage. It may be effective in treating diseases related to oxidative stress, such as diabetes and cancer.
SourceMethoxatin/pyrroloquinoline quinone (PQQ) is mostly seen in plants, few bacteria and single cell eukaryotes, like yeast. It is mainly obtained from methylotrophic bacteria. PQQ may also present in the tissues of mammals.
Biochem/physiol ActionsIn bacteria, pyrroloquinoline quinone (PQQ) is used as a redox cycling cofactor. It acts as a cofactor (prosthetic group) for enzyme-catalyzed redox reactions of glucose and methanol dehydrogenase(s). PQQ is used in liposomes to establish a simple homogeneous assay for the detection of membrane permeabilization by antimicrobial peptides and synthetic copolymers. In bovine plasma amine oxidase, methoxatin may acts as the cofactor.
